Program Overview

The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ration and Management at ESIC Valencia equips you with essential organizational, intellectual, and technical skills to thrive in today's fast-paced business world, perfect for ambitious students eager to lead organizations through change. You'll gain a solid foundation in management, strategy, finance, and marketing, with flexible itineraries like a 4-year option (240 ECTS + Specialization Diploma in Professional Skills for €10,200) or a 5-year double degree with Marketing Management (375 ECTS for €10,600), plus international experiences from year 3 including 6-month Erasmus or Munde-ESIC stays.

 

### Curriculum Structure
Year 1 lays the groundwork by immersing you in foundational business concepts and economic principles, starting with subjects like Economic History, Corporate Mathematics, and Introduction to Corporations I to build your analytical mindset. You'll also explore Professional Ethics, Basic Principles of Law and Equality alongside History of Spanish Institutions (Humanities), helping you understand the ethical and historical contexts that shape modern businesses while developing critical thinking from day one.

Year 2 shifts toward practical economics and tools, diving into Introduction to Economics, Financial Mathematics, and Introduction to Corporations II to sharpen your grasp of financial operations and company structures. Courses like Mercantile Law and Computer Science Applied to Marketing prepare you for real-world legal challenges and digital tools, setting the stage for strategic decision-making.

Year 3 ramps up with advanced strategy and operations, featuring Cost Accounting, Strategic Management and Corporate Politics I, and Financial Management I to teach you how to analyze costs, craft strategies, and manage finances effectively. You'll tackle Product Policy and Market Research, gaining hands-on skills in consumer insights and product development that directly apply to dynamic markets.

Year 4 culminates in leadership and global expertise through electives like Business Simulator, Organizational Behaviour and Design, and Corporate Accounting, simulating real business scenarios to hone your management prowess. Wrap up with Global and International Marketing, Corporate Assessment and Acquisition, and your Final Degree Project, preparing you to evaluate companies, navigate international trade, and step into professional roles confidently.
